On Tue, Mar 29, 2022 at 9:47 AM Dilip Kumar <dilipbalaut(at)gmail(dot)com> wrote:
>
> On Thu, Mar 24, 2022 at 11:24 PM Zheng Li <zhengli10(at)gmail(dot)com> wrote:
> >
> >
> > Good catch. The reason for having isTopLevel in the condition is
> > because I haven't decided if a DDL statement inside a PL should
> > be replicated from the user point of view. For example, if I execute a
> > plpgsql function or a stored procedure which creates a table under the hood,
> > does it always make sense to replicate the DDL without running the same
> > function or stored procedure on the subscriber? It probably depends on
> > the specific
> > use case. Maybe we can consider making this behavior configurable by the user.
>
> But then this could be true for DML as well right? Like after
> replicating the function to the subscriber if we are sending the DML
> done by function then what's the problem in DDL. I mean if there is
> no design issue in implementing this then I don't think there is much
> point in blocking the same or even providing configuration for this.
>
Valid point. I think if there are some design/implementation
constraints for this then it is better to document those(probably as
comments).
